The U.S. OEM parts and machinery manufacturing sector continues to expand, driven by increasing demand for precision components across industries such as automotive, aerospace, industrial equipment, and healthcare. According to Grand View Research, the global industrial machinery market size was valued at USD 503.3 billion in 2022 and is expected to grow at a compound annual growth rate (CAGR) of 5.8% from 2023 to 2030, with the United States remaining one of the largest contributors to this growth. This momentum is fueled by advancements in automation, rising investments in reshoring manufacturing operations, and strong supply chain integration. As demand for reliable, high-performance OEM components intensifies, domestic manufacturers are positioning themselves as leaders in quality and innovation. 2026 Market Trends for OEM Parts in the Machinery Sector: USA Outlook

The U.S. market for Original Equipment Manufacturer (OEM) parts within the machinery sector is poised for significant transformation by 2026, driven by technological advancements, supply chain reevaluation, and evolving industrial demands. Here’s a detailed analysis of the key trends shaping this critical industry segment.

Rising Demand for Advanced, Integrated Components

By 2026, OEM machinery manufacturers will increasingly demand parts that support automation, connectivity, and efficiency. Components embedded with sensors (IoT-enabled), designed for predictive maintenance, and compatible with Industry 4.0 systems will see heightened adoption. This shift is particularly evident in sectors like construction, agriculture, and industrial equipment, where uptime and data-driven operations are paramount. Suppliers who innovate in smart hydraulics, precision actuators, and modular electronic control units will gain competitive advantage.

Supply Chain Resilience and Nearshoring Momentum

Ongoing global disruptions and geopolitical uncertainties will continue to push OEMs toward reshoring and nearshoring strategies. By 2026, a growing percentage of U.S.-based machinery OEMs will prioritize domestic sourcing for critical components to mitigate risks. This trend benefits American part manufacturers, especially those investing in automation and flexible production lines. Government incentives under infrastructure and CHIPS Act-like programs may further bolster local supply chains, increasing demand for U.S.-made bearings, transmissions, and fabricated metal parts.

Sustainability and Regulatory Pressures

Environmental regulations and corporate sustainability goals will influence OEM part design and materials. By 2026, there will be greater demand for energy-efficient components, recyclable materials, and parts that reduce emissions across the machinery lifecycle. OEMs may require suppliers to provide carbon footprint data and adhere to stricter environmental standards. Lightweight composites, high-efficiency motors, and low-friction coatings will become more prevalent as part of greener machinery solutions.

Digitalization of Parts Procurement and Inventory Management

Digital platforms and AI-driven inventory systems will transform how OEMs source and manage parts. Predictive analytics will enable just-in-time (JIT) delivery models, reducing warehousing costs and minimizing downtime. By 2026, digital twins for parts and blockchain for traceability could become standard in high-value machinery segments. Suppliers who offer real-time inventory visibility and integrated e-procurement solutions will be preferred partners.

Workforce and Skills Gap Challenges

As machinery parts become more technologically sophisticated, the shortage of skilled workers in manufacturing and maintenance will intensify. OEMs may favor suppliers who provide comprehensive training, detailed digital documentation, and remote support. Automation in part production will help offset labor constraints, but investments in workforce development—particularly in mechatronics and digital maintenance—will be crucial for long-term competitiveness.

Logistics & Compliance Guide for OEM Parts and Machinery in the USA

Navigating the logistics and compliance landscape for Original Equipment Manufacturer (OEM) parts and machinery in the United States requires careful planning and adherence to federal, state, and industry-specific regulations. This guide outlines key considerations to ensure smooth operations, avoid penalties, and maintain supply chain efficiency.

Import Regulations and Customs Compliance

All OEM parts and machinery entering the United States are subject to U.S. Customs and Border Protection (CBP) regulations. Accurate classification under the Harmonized Tariff Schedule (HTS) is essential for determining applicable duties and eligibility for trade agreements. Importers must provide detailed commercial invoices, packing lists, and bills of lading. Special attention is required for machinery containing controlled materials or originating from sanctioned countries. Utilizing a licensed customs broker can streamline the entry process and ensure compliance with all documentation requirements.

Product Safety and Certification Standards

OEM machinery and parts must comply with U.S. safety standards enforced by agencies such as OSHA, the Consumer Product Safety Commission (CPSC), and Underwriters Laboratories (UL). Electrical components may require UL, ETL, or CSA certification. Heavy machinery must adhere to ANSI and NFPA standards for operational safety. Labeling must include voltage, wattage, and manufacturer information in English. Non-compliant products risk seizure, fines, or mandatory recalls.

Environmental and Hazardous Materials Compliance

Machinery containing refrigerants, oils, or batteries may be subject to Environmental Protection Agency (EPA) regulations. Proper handling, labeling, and disposal of hazardous components are required under the Resource Conservation and Recovery Act (RCRA). Equipment emitting pollutants must meet EPA emission standards. Importers and distributors must comply with Toxic Substances Control Act (TSCA) requirements, including submitting TSCA compliance affidavits for certain chemical-containing parts.

Transportation and Freight Logistics

Selecting the appropriate mode of transport—air, ocean, rail, or truck—is critical based on part size, weight, urgency, and cost. Oversized or heavy machinery may require special permits and routing approvals from state departments of transportation. Proper crating, blocking, and bracing are essential to prevent damage during transit. Real-time tracking and insurance coverage should be arranged to mitigate risks. Engaging freight forwarders experienced in industrial shipments ensures regulatory and logistical best practices.

Domestic Distribution and Warehousing

Once cleared through customs, OEM parts must be stored in compliant facilities. Warehouses should follow OSHA safety guidelines, including fire suppression systems, proper shelving, and hazardous material segregation. Inventory management systems should support traceability for quality control and recall readiness. Distribution centers must be strategically located to optimize delivery times to manufacturers or service centers.

Recordkeeping and Audit Preparedness

Maintain comprehensive records of import transactions, certifications, safety testing, and supply chain documentation for a minimum of five years, as required by CBP and other federal agencies. These records should include bills of lading, customs entries, test reports, and supplier compliance declarations. Regular internal audits help identify compliance gaps and prepare for potential government inspections.

Trade Agreement Utilization and Duty Savings

Explore eligibility for duty reductions under free trade agreements such as USMCA (United States-Mexico-Canada Agreement). OEM parts that meet rules of origin criteria may qualify for preferential tariff treatment. Ensure that suppliers provide valid Certificates of Origin and maintain documented supply chain traceability to substantiate claims during audits.
